What impact can AI have on the job market?

The rapid evolution of Artificial Intelligence (AI) is fundamentally transforming the way we live and work. As this technology advances, it is inevitable to consider the impact it will have on the job market. From automating tasks to creating new job opportunities, AI is shaping the future of work in complex and multifaceted ways.

The dynamics between AI and the market

The relationship between AI and the market is multifaceted. On the one hand, AI-driven automation could result in the replacement of repetitive and routine tasks. On the other hand, AI also opens doors to new employment opportunities, requiring specific skills related to the development, implementation and maintenance of AI systems.

Emerging challenges and opportunities

A crucial challenge is the need to retrain the workforce. As AI automates tasks, workers need to adapt and acquire skills complementary to the technology. However, AI also brings with it new professions and sectors, such as data engineering and AI ethics, offering opportunities for growth and innovation.

The connection between AI and human resources

The Human Resources (HR) sector is undergoing a significant transformation driven by AI. From screening candidates to developing talent retention strategies, HR professionals are using algorithms to optimize processes and personalize experiences for employees.

Skills valued in an AI-driven world

With the advancement of AI , certain human skills are becoming increasingly crucial:

  • Data interpretation: Ability to extract insights from large data sets.
  • Machine Learning and AI: Understanding the fundamental principles of AI and the ability to apply them.
  • Critical thinking and problem solving: Ability to analyze complex information and make strategic decisions.
  • Criativity and innovation: Ability to think creatively and generate innovative solutions.
  • Social and emotional skills: Ability to relate and collaborate effectively with others.
  • Adaptability and flexibility: Ability to adjust to new technologies and constantly evolving work environments.
  • Leadership and team management: Ability to lead teams in a diverse and interconnected environment.
  • Digital Communication Skills: Ability to communicate effectively across digital platforms and collaborate virtually.
